I don't know if this counts as what you want, but Three Body Problem! It is a little complex, and it is about extraterrestrial life. It takes place during the Chinese revolution and basically is about sending signals to outer space. And they find a world that has 3 suns. There is also a VR game that mimics that world, and the story continues. It is VERY science based, and sometimes I got lost, but it was a very interesting read!

The Silent Patient! That was the book that first got me into my reading addiction, and I read it when I was around 13. It's a pretty easy read, but it is a little dark. Without spoilers, it is basically about a woman who killed her husband and is at court mandated therapy. You read from the perspective of the therapist.
